Transaction 4c72add2237a13f68346e046ae72de5779510a4b71397048f58142cc69051107
1 Input
1 Output
-
4c72add2237a13f68346e046ae72de5779510a4b71397048f58142cc69051107:0
- value
- 3450014
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 262845a73458e7944df2df2b986da37e6c31ec89 OP_EQUAL
- address
- 35AmqzBPRiF6utaWmkEDQ765qLwqNnTfnu